The Power of Tile Evaluation and Hand Management
Successful dominoes players begin their strategic planning the moment they evaluate their starting hand. You must categorize your tiles based on their suits and identify any repeating numbers that could allow you to control the board. Keeping a balanced hand is essential because it ensures you have playable options regardless of how your opponent changes the line of play.
Another vital aspect of hand management is the timely release of high-value tiles, especially doublets. Holding onto heavy tiles like the double-six for too long poses a massive risk, as you might get stuck with them if the game blocks. Playing these high-scoring pieces early reduces your potential point loss if your opponent manages to dominate the round.
Tactical Defense and Block Strategies
Defensive play is what truly separates seasoned experts from enthusiastic beginners in any standard match. By carefully observing which numbers your opponents decline to play, you can deduce the gaps in their hands and actively work to starve them of those options. Forcing your opponent to draw from the boneyard remains one of the most effective ways to disrupt their momentum and gain a massive tile advantage.
When the board begins to tighten, transitioning to a dedicated blocking strategy can secure a decisive victory. If you hold the majority of a specific number, you can play to ensure both open ends of the line feature that digit, effectively stalling the entire table. Calculating the remaining tiles in play before executing a block will help you guarantee that you end up with the lowest pip count.
Pattern Recognition and Mental Math Skills
To truly excel at competitive dominoes, players must develop exceptional pattern recognition and mental mathematics. Tracking the twenty-eight tiles in a standard double-six set allows you to calculate the probability of which pieces are still hidden. This cognitive habit turns every match from a game of chance into a calculated sequence of predictable moves.
